Why Season 1 of Fringe is a Sci-Fi Essential
The debut season of (2008–2009) serves as a foundational exploration of "The Pattern," a series of inexplicable, gruesome phenomena that blur the line between scientific possibility and science fiction. While initially criticized for its procedural, "freak-of-the-week" structure, the season eventually evolves into a complex serialized drama that explores themes of ethics, loss, and parallel realities.
